In this engaging discussion, Matthew Pollard, a bestselling author known as the Rapid Growth guy, dives into the unique advantages of introverts in networking. He shares insights on how introverts can leverage their listening skills and empathy to create authentic connections. Matthew also recounts his personal journey and emphasizes the importance of specialization for career growth. He provides practical strategies for introverts to redefine their professional identities and thrive in competitive environments, challenging stereotypes and empowering listeners.

INSIGHT

Introvert Strengths in Networking

  • Introverts have a natural advantage in networking due to their strengths like listening and empathy.
  • Transactional and shallow networking are ineffective compared to authentic engagement leveraging introverts' skills.
ANECDOTE

From Introvert to Sales Success

  • Matthew Pollard began in commission-only door-to-door sales despite being a shy introvert.
  • He self-taught sales via YouTube and was promoted seven times, showing introverts can excel with the right guidance.
ADVICE

Craft Unique Professional Identity

  • Create a unique professional identity beyond just your functional role to spark curiosity.
  • Use a compelling mission statement and storytelling to emotionally engage people and differentiate yourself.
